Meet the speaker: Prof. Deeph Chana
Managing Director, NATO Defence Innovation Accelerator for the North Atlantic (DIANA)
Prof Chana has joined DIANA as its first Managing Director, bringing with him extensive experience of leading innovative science and technology research and development in academia, industry and government, focusing on global risks and next generation infrastructure security. He is joining DIANA from Imperial College London where he was Director of the Institute for Security Science and Technology and Co-Director of the Centre for Financial Technology within Imperial College Business School.
Prof Chana has consulted and lectured worldwide with businesses and governments on the nature and implications of disruptive and emerging technologies, and he has several decades of experience in technology entrepreneurship, covering a wide range of applications spanning quantum cascade laser detectors to materials science.
Established by the current Secretary General, Prof Chana was the founding Chair of NATO’s Advisory Group on Emerging and Disruptive Technologies and is currently a high-level science advisor to the UK’s Ministry of Defence. Prof Chana holds MSci and PhD degrees in Physics from King’s College London.

Meet the panelist: Dr. Mike Hoffman
Director of Curriculum (AI Engineering), Corndel
Dr. Mike Hoffman is the Director of Curriculum (AI Engineering) at Corndel, where he leads the new and exciting ML engineering apprenticeship. He previously developed a novel Data Engineering apprenticeship standard, having also served as Senior Lecturer in Computer Science and Cyber Security – teaching programming, secure architectures and cloud technologies. Outside of education, Mike worked in multiple industry technology roles from investment banking to online travel and music streaming.
Outside the realm of tech, Mike is a qualified psychotherapist, merging his passion for teaching, mentoring and coaching with societal demands of living an ever-evolving digital world. A distinguished graduate of Imperial, with an MEng in Software Engineering, an MSc in Psychology, and a PhD in Web Science, Dr Hoffman believes in harnessing technology to foster curiosity, fairness, and the well-being of individuals and communities.
